The mining ship named "Red Dwarf", is a massive, city-sized spaceship owned and maintained by the Jupiter Mining Company (or JMC). The Red Dwarf was designed to accommodate 11,169 crew members consisting of engineers, doctors, chefs, pilots and various other professions.

However, on their voyage to Saturn's moon "Titan" the entirety of the crew went missing and have never been heard of since. No distress signal was ever received either.

The JMC Red Dwarf is an enormous mining craft, measuring ten kilometers in length and is one of the oldest and largest vessels in commission for the Jupiter Mining Corporation, crewed by the M.T.O Space Pilots and commanded by Captain Adolf Hitler II. The ship was designed to be far longer and larger but this design was changed after the JMC made considerable cutbacks due to financial problems at the time. At the ship's front is the Front Ramscoop that collects traces of hydrogen and helium in space.

The Engine Core powers the ship, and the Ramscoop would allow the ship to theoretically keep running forever with an endless source of fuel. There is also a large number of solar panels and battery back-ups but due to the massive drain of power these could only maintain the ship for a few weeks without the main engines.
